Nature – the protector and healer



Sometimes even the most sophisticated and advanced medical treatments cannot compete with Nature! Getting close to Nature and exposure to natural elements like the sun, wind and water can be the remedial solution to many ailments.

Naturopathy is a therapy and line of treatment that relies exclusively on Nature for curing. It is based on the belief that the human body is designed for self-healing with the capacity to repair when exposed to a healthy environment. This system of healing was practiced by our forefathers and is now being promoted by scientists and physicians over the world.

Research has shown that contact with Nature can have dramatic positive results on our health. Basking under the sun for just a few minutes can also help supply bone-building vitamin D. New evidence shows that natural beauty, even in small doses can do wonders to our well-being. Researchers now suggest that passive contact with nature, like looking at trees from a window, can be as therapeutic as a walk in the woods.

Nature can be the reliever in decreasing mental fatigue, enhancing concentration and perking up your spirits. Just sitting by the sea-shore and watching the sparkling sea and listening to rippling waves can ease all your tensions. Your can feel your muscles relax, body pain vanish and your emotions reaching a new high.

Nature is also one of the best prescriptions to drive away your blues and cure depression. Turning to Nature, when you’re feeling down, can Instantly elevate your mood. Hippocrates, the father of modern medicine, recognized this powerful healing quality of nature and aptly said, "Nature cures – not the physician"

Here are some simple ways to connect with Nature


  • Go take a walk! Unclog your brains with some fresh, natural air. It will not only activate you heart to pump more oxygen, but can alter your mood and inspire you
  • OutingWork out in natural surroundings and sweat it out in the great outdoors
  • Get your hands dirty and explore gardening. Shoveling a rake, watering plants, digging holes, pulling out weeds can be very relaxing.
  • Relax under the shade of a tree, or roll in the mud or just potter around taking in the greenery
  • Go to the terrace and watch the last few rays of the setting sun, or the glorious glow produced by the moon on a full moon night
